Hi,

Is there a way to rollback the Portico update? Although there are improvements the update has messed up things that were fine.

I remember you used to be able to do it using Zune on WP7.5 but is there a way with WP8?

Thanks :smile:

Because Zune isn't compatible with WP8 I'd imagine you would have to flash your phone manually. If you have a Lumia you can do it using Nokia care Suite but Navifirm is about to be shut down (if it hasn't already been) so unless you have a copy of the previous firmware already downloaded you're pretty much stuffed. I don't know where firmwares can be obtained for HTC's or Samsungs (sammobile.com aren't hosting firmwares for the Ativ S).

well, depends on your device. With a Lumia, you can just do it with the Nokia Care Suite.

I had to restore stock 8.0, because Portico failed to install (error 7008000d), so I chose restore (not only refurbish), selected the Firmware and followed the step. It was easy and solved my problems :)
